0

私はswfuploadを使用しており、多数の「ファイルの添付」リンクがあり、それぞれが1つのswfuploadインスタンスに関連付けられた同じJqueryダイアログを開きます。カスタム投稿パラメータを設定しようとしましたが、失敗します:www.arianhojat.com/temp/code/swfupload/index.html

'setPostParam'行を削除すると、問題はありませんが、idはparamsを設定するのが好きです...それはfirebugでエラーを出します: "キャッチされない例外:SetPostParamsへの呼び出しが失敗しました" .. ..

そこで、代わりに別の解決策を試しました...ダイアログが開くたびにswfuploadオブジェクトを再作成し、閉じた後に破棄します...しかし、「キャッチされない例外:Flash要素が見つかりませんでした」というメッセージが表示されます。最後に。リンクを再度クリックしてもポップアップが表示されるため、これが重大なエラーであるかどうかはわかりません。私はこれがおそらく進むべき道かもしれないと思いますが、そのエラーについてはよくわかりません

これが実際のそのコードの私のオンライン例です: http ://www.arianhojat.com/temp/code/swfupload/index_destroy.html

(PSファイルのアップロードはダイアログを閉じてエラーを警告する必要があります。Javaサーブレットバックエンドに対応するホスト設定が今はないので、処理する必要があります...最初にフロントエンドを動作させて取り除きたいだけですそのエラーなので、私のようなFirebugユーザーがjsエラーの発生に気付くことなく、エラーは最初に適切に処理されます。)

4

1 に答える 1

2

cssポジショニングを使用して非表示にし(display:block / none;ではなく)、Flashを非表示/再表示したときにFlashがリロードされるときにダイアログを表示する必要があります。

于 2010-08-03T15:58:46.283 に答える